## Deployment

The Lumacache image service has a known slow leak in its thumbnail cache layer: evicted entries keep a reference alive through the decoder pool, so resident memory creeps up roughly 40 MB per hour under steady load. Until the refactor in the Harkness branch lands, we mitigate by capping pool size and scheduling a rolling restart every 12 hours. Deploy with the supervisor, never bare, or the restart hook won't fire. The deployment relies on the configuration values listed below.

settings of bagug-tahof:
holath:
  pin: 7837
  metrics_host: metrics.holath.tolvaqsys.internal
  tenant: quenath
  seal: seal_6001b3af

Ticket: Config drift in Slatepress incremental rebuilds

Priority: High. Assignee: release manager.

Incremental rebuilds on Slatepress prod are diverging from staging. Prod skips the partial-index step; staging doesn't. Root cause: someone hand-edited prod's rebuild config last sprint and it never landed in the repo. Result: stale category pages after every content push. Need prod reverted to the committed baseline before Thursday's release. Do not hotfix prod again. The committed baseline values that prod must match are these.

service settings:
[casax]
port = 6379
team = rusir
host = casax.zemvarhq.corp
region = outer-4
access_code = ac_9808ce
timeout_ms = 1500

During the transition, both build paths
// run in CI; the shim decides which artifacts are authoritative. On-call: if
// hermetic builds start failing, the fallback flag reroutes to the legacy
// toolchain automatically — do not flip it by hand unless the reroute itself
// is broken. Timeouts here are deliberately generous because Stonecourse's
// cold cache is slow. Sync any change with the values pinned in the release
// manifest. The constants in effect are listed below.

limits module of fajog-kahag:
QUOTAS = {
    "druael": 1,
    "zorath": 10,
    "druath": 1,
    "druwyn": 5,
}

Subject: Key rotation for InvoiceForge renderer

Welcome, new folks. Every quarter we rotate the credential the Pellworth PDF invoice renderer uses to call our internal asset service, Vaultline. The old key stops working Friday at noon. Update your local .env and the staging config before then, and verify a test invoice renders with the new embedded fonts. For convenience, the freshly issued key is included here.

app token of bagef-bageg = kto11_vuwA0uhrEMg